At Ford Motor Company, we are seeking an experienced MP&L Supervisor to join our team. As an MP&L Supervisor, you will be responsible for coaching Safety, Quality, and Productivity teams to ensure objectives are met through standardized work. You will also monitor and respond to andon occurrences, verify process confirmation, and support continuous improvement.
Key responsibilities include:
- Coaching Safety, Quality, and Productivity teams to ensure objectives are met through standardized work
- Monitoring and responding to andon occurrences
- Verifying process confirmation to ensure safe, smooth, and quality production
- Supporting continuous improvement and problem resolution
- Building Team Leader and Team Member capability
- Creating a conducive work environment for teams
- Basic administration of supervisory responsibilities and documents
- Ensuring proper material flow from receiving dock to production line feed location
- Providing direction and support in resource allocation
- Supporting Ford Production System and synchronous material flow through lean manufacturing practices
Successful candidates will have a high school diploma and prior experience working in body shops, stamping, or subassembly, or manufacturing assembly and machining. A bachelor's degree in Industrial Operations, Transportation & Logistics, Supply Chain Management & Information Systems, Applied Engineering Science, Packaging Engineering, or Business Mgmt. is preferred.
The ideal candidate will have strong organizational and administrative skills, ability to multi-task, and strong problem-solving and conflict management skills. Leadership in One FORD behaviors combined with outstanding interpersonal, teambuilding, and communication skills are essential.
